diff options
author | Vincent Untz <vincent@vuntz.net> | 2004-11-28 21:23:44 +0800 |
---|---|---|
committer | Christian Persch <chpe@src.gnome.org> | 2004-11-28 21:23:44 +0800 |
commit | 041bddfb968be8da138709344bae3d0048fb201a (patch) | |
tree | 7b4ac93f5cfff7ed764b20e0ec319070b47b2d2b /src | |
parent | dc615e9fff14aef2891db0bbc30af8a6ceccc9c5 (diff) | |
download | gsoc2013-epiphany-041bddfb968be8da138709344bae3d0048fb201a.tar gsoc2013-epiphany-041bddfb968be8da138709344bae3d0048fb201a.tar.gz gsoc2013-epiphany-041bddfb968be8da138709344bae3d0048fb201a.tar.bz2 gsoc2013-epiphany-041bddfb968be8da138709344bae3d0048fb201a.tar.lz gsoc2013-epiphany-041bddfb968be8da138709344bae3d0048fb201a.tar.xz gsoc2013-epiphany-041bddfb968be8da138709344bae3d0048fb201a.tar.zst gsoc2013-epiphany-041bddfb968be8da138709344bae3d0048fb201a.zip |
Fixes leak.
2004-11-28 Vincent Untz <vincent@vuntz.net>
* src/bookmarks/ephy-bookmarksbar-model.c: (impl_get_item_id):
Fixes leak.
Diffstat (limited to 'src')
-rwxr-xr-x | src/bookmarks/ephy-bookmarksbar-model.c |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/src/bookmarks/ephy-bookmarksbar-model.c b/src/bookmarks/ephy-bookmarksbar-model.c index 0bbcad7c5..a682906d6 100755 --- a/src/bookmarks/ephy-bookmarksbar-model.c +++ b/src/bookmarks/ephy-bookmarksbar-model.c @@ -332,7 +332,10 @@ impl_get_item_id (EggToolbarsModel *eggmodel, gchar **netscape_url; netscape_url = g_strsplit (name, "\n", 2); - if (!netscape_url || !netscape_url[URL]) return NULL; + if (!netscape_url || !netscape_url[URL]) { + g_strfreev (netscape_url); + return NULL; + } node = ephy_bookmarks_find_bookmark (bookmarks, netscape_url[URL]); |